This is the part most ad networks get wrong. We get it right by design.
Advertisers submit their creative (text and images) to us. We serve it from our infrastructure. There is no direct connection between the advertiser and you. None.
Advertisers cannot add their own tracking pixels, scripts, cookies, or any tracking mechanism to their ads. No third-party code runs in our ad units. We are the wall between the advertiser and the user.
Advertisers receive aggregated stats — total impressions, total clicks, country breakdown — through our dashboard only. They never get data about individual users, because we don't have any.
We believe we're GDPR compliant because we don't store personal data. No cookies means no consent banner. No user profiles means nothing to delete. IP addresses are processed in memory for country detection and never written to disk.
